diff --git a/src/Umbraco.Web.UI.Client/src/packages/media/media/tree/manifests.ts b/src/Umbraco.Web.UI.Client/src/packages/media/media/tree/manifests.ts index a2ed7ff1dc..adb11b1d18 100644 --- a/src/Umbraco.Web.UI.Client/src/packages/media/media/tree/manifests.ts +++ b/src/Umbraco.Web.UI.Client/src/packages/media/media/tree/manifests.ts @@ -44,7 +44,15 @@ const treeItem: ManifestTreeItem = { name: 'Media Tree Item', element: () => import('./tree-item/media-tree-item.element.js'), api: () => import('./tree-item/media-tree-item.context.js'), - forEntityTypes: [UMB_MEDIA_ROOT_ENTITY_TYPE, UMB_MEDIA_ENTITY_TYPE], + forEntityTypes: [UMB_MEDIA_ENTITY_TYPE], +}; + +const rootTreeItem: ManifestTreeItem = { + type: 'treeItem', + kind: 'default', + alias: 'Umb.TreeItem.Media.Root', + name: 'Media Tree Root', + forEntityTypes: [UMB_MEDIA_ROOT_ENTITY_TYPE], }; export const manifests: Array = [ @@ -52,5 +60,6 @@ export const manifests: Array = [ treeStore, tree, treeItem, + rootTreeItem, ...reloadTreeItemChildrenManifests, ];